Winter Birding at Yellow Creek
Sat, February 16, 2019, 8:00 am
Seph Mack Boy Scout Camp
Outing Leader: Tom Glover, , 814-938-5618
Description
Winter birding at Yellow Creek, led by Tom Glover (814-938-5618, tomnglover@comcast.net). Meet at the parking lot of the Boy Scout Camp Seph Mack on the north shore of Yellow Creek State Park at 8:00 a.m. We will explore the camp for foraging birds. Take US Rt. 422 east from Indiana for about 8 miles. Look for signs for the North Shore and the Boy Scout Camp. Turn right onto S. Harmony Rd. for about 2 miles then turn right into the camp.
